What are the forms of classroom grouping?

The forms of classroom grouping: random grouping, homogeneous grouping, heterogeneous grouping and cooperative grouping.

1, random grouping: This is the most basic form of group teaching. The so-called random grouping is to divide students into several groups according to certain methods. It is often used in competitions and games. The advantage of this method lies in its simplicity and rapidity. The disadvantage is that students' interests and abilities are not considered, and the teaching principle of differential treatment cannot be well reflected.

2. Homogeneous grouping: The so-called homogeneous grouping means that students in the same group have roughly the same physical fitness and motor skills after grouping. The advantages are that it can enhance the competitiveness of activities, conform to students' competitive personality and improve students' interest in participating in activities; The disadvantage is that it is easy to form a hierarchical concept among students and an inferiority complex among the disadvantaged groups.

3. Heterogeneous grouping: after grouping, students in the same group have differences in physical fitness and sports skills, and there is little difference in overall strength between groups. It artificially groups students with different physical qualities and sports skills into one group, or groups them according to a special need, so as to narrow the gap between groups and facilitate the development of games and competitions.

4. Cooperation grouping: physical education class students have more opportunities to cooperate than other courses, which is mainly determined by the characteristics of sports activities. Whether it is a game or a competition, cooperation is one of the important factors for success. In physical education teaching, letting students practice through cooperation goes far beyond the activity itself.

Advantages of group teaching:

1, group teaching is more suitable for students' personal level and characteristics than class teaching, which is convenient for teaching students in accordance with their aptitude and conducive to the cultivation of talents.

2. It is convenient for students to communicate and cooperate; It is helpful to cultivate students' organizational ability, management ability, expression ability and problem-solving ability.

3. In the competition and cooperation with group members, it helps students to enhance their learning motivation.
